Cops are investigating the gruesome murder of a man who was found near a graveyard with a hole in his head in an Overberg dorpie.
According to police spokesperson Constable Noloyiso Rwexana, the body of the 27-year-old man was discovered next to the cemetery in Riviersonderend on Sunday evening.
A resident who knew the victim says Quintin van der Sandt was last seen alive in Riviersonderend on Saturday afternoon.
“The next day his family became worried and started looking for him,” says the man, who asked to remain anonymous.
“His body was discovered on Sunday night close to the cemetery. Apparently he had a hole in his head and a jacket was thrown over his head.
“His silver Volkswagen Caddie was found on the road near Ashton.”
He adds that forensic analysts searched the vehicle and found a blood-stained spanner and blood splatter inside the vehicle which was abandoned at the side of the road.
Rwexana confirmed that the vehicle was found in Ashton but says the deceased was not reported as missing.
“No one has been arrested at this stage,” says Rwexana.
